1. Be a GM
- get selected to go to all star team, iihf worlds... for both BaGM and BaP
- hire coaches and have budgets
- training camps, and notifications of ahl kids that should come up
- be able to see stats of all signed prospects
- Sign players from overseas when free agents
- morale meter to show when players are happy
- scouting sheet for each game for both your team and opposition (hot/cold, if they put in a fighter)
- Have all unsigned international prospects in the system!!!!!!!!!!!!!

2. Be a Pro
- request trade in BaP
- have off season training
- after game "interviews", locker room talks, etc.
- celebrations when breaking records

3. Trading/free agents
- prospect trade value higher, and the potential rank stays longer
-on trade deadline, show teams as buyer/seller, and exactly what they want (shut down D, gritty forward, top 3 playmaker....)
- have free agents have wants (contender, money, close to home)

4. Scouting
- have letter grades for specific attributes (shot, vision, bodychecking,) instead of numbers, but keep the accuracy/inaccuracy
- create draft list of scouted prospects and ceiling potentials

Ultimate customization (IN player sense alone) seems like it has never been addressed.
When going into edit pro, there should be loads of different option's.
Physical:thickness, chest size, calf thickness, thigh thickness etc.. When looking at Stamkos from a physical perspective, you can see that his 6''1' 188 body is lengthy and not bulky, yet when seeing him in the game he looks about 15 pounds heavier especially in his legs.
Face:Although EA is famous for pre-setup not changeable face types, being able to change the face of your guy; sony's road to the show??
Gear size/alteration: you can see vast difference's in similar players in real life, about baggy-ness of their breezer's, the tuck of there jersey(and show the back of there specific breezers too, not the stupid jersey anti-fighting strap). Kessel wears slightly long baggy breezers. Stamkos, Skinner and so many others tape there stick all the way from heel to toe completely covered, Ovechkin tapes his just toe to mid blade. THIS STUFF IS SO BASIC but, adds so much individuality. Also Brad Richards has some pretty big glove's, some other guy's like small tight, like say Tyler Seguin.
Skating Style: Does Ovechkin skate like Crosby? Does Stamkos skate like Kovalchuk? no, so why does everyone all skate the same! Add in the ability for a violent skater(Ovechkin) or lengthy stride(Stammer or Gaborik during his Wild days) or even Duchene like a machine the way his legs never stop (you gotta witness to understand)
Shooting/hand style: Although this would be very very unlikely, Being able to have your guy very stand up style or hunched over would be nice.

I'll just make an acknowledgement to Presentation broadcast play by play guys because, this has been THEEE biggest annoyance to me as the last few games have come. Doc emerick is and will be for the next for years, the best play by play in the game. Why the F&^% do we have the guys we do on here? there so frickin lame! even Benninatti is better.

Puck physics: since when in hockey has the puck been so lifeless? So easy to keep for so long? The puck is constantly shifting, moving, floating, wobbling in real games.. It seems that EA is catering to this stupid Dangle end to end control the puck on your stick everywhere you go crowd(Which for sales is understandable) But, hockey is not in any way like that. Dump and chase, chip in, etc etc. People don't realize that with all this puck control you lose all the important things like positioning awareness sense etc etc. If you could walk in everytime and dangle 24/7 the nhl wouldn't have any care about getting playmakers, shutdown d-man, mobile passing d-men, guys that can sit in front of the net and chip home a rebound. There's just no grinding or work at all being done in these game's and that makes any goal or good play seem unimportant or generic. No one in hockey would celebrate as much as they do when they score if it was so easy, so don't make it so in the game.
